INDUS Technology, Inc.

About

In 1991, INDUS Technology was founded in San Diego, California with a clear vision: to provide superior systems engineering, technical, and program management services to government and industry clients. What began as a rapidly growing firm has evolved into a 100% employee-owned,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business (SDVOSB) that has become a well-known and sought-after contractor in the Defense Industry.

Today, INDUS delivers mission-focused solutions across Engineering, Information Technology, Cybersecurity, Program and Financial Management, Logistics, and Data Analytics. Through superior technical performance, strategic partnerships with prime contractors, and active engagement in defense-related community activities, the company has established itself as a trusted partner to the Department of the Navy, other DoD agencies, and the Federal Government. With headquarters in San Diego and offices spanning from Port Hueneme, CA to Keyport, WA; Honolulu, HI; Newport, RI; Chesapeake, VA; Charleston, SC; and Panama City, FL - along with personnel serving throughout the US, Guam, and Japan - INDUS exemplifies its belief that "there is no them and us, simply US."

iRhythm Technologies, Inc.

In 2006, iRhythm Technologies was founded with a clear mission: to create a fundamentally better way to diagnose heart arrhythmias. The founders recognized that traditional cardiac monitoring methods were often uncomfortable, inconvenient, and missed critical data. They envisioned a patient-friendly solution that could capture continuous, high-quality ECG data over extended periods. This insight led to the development of the Zio ECG monitor - a wearable, single-use patch that patients can wear comfortably for up to 14 days, transforming the diagnostic experience for millions. Today, iRhythm stands as a leading digital healthcare company that has served over 8 million patients and analyzed more than 1.5 billion hours of heartbeat data. The company's innovative platform combines FDA-cleared AI algorithms with deep-learning technology clinically proven to be as accurate as expert cardiologists. With operations across the United States, United Kingdom, and Japan, iRhythm continues to push boundaries in cardiac care. The company went public on Nasdaq (IRTC) and under the leadership of CEO Quentin Blackford, remains relentlessly focused on its mission to boldly innovate trusted solutions that detect, predict, and prevent disease.

Akamai Technologies, Inc.

Akamai Technologies operates one of the world's most distributed cloud computing platforms, spanning more than 135 countries and serving billions of users daily. The company's infrastructure sits at the intersection of content delivery, edge computing, and cybersecurity - positioning compute and security controls closer to end users rather than in centralized data centers. This architecture underpins both performance optimization for web and mobile applications and threat mitigation at scale. The company's technical stack centers on its Intelligent Edge Platform, which handles content delivery network (CDN) operations, DDoS mitigation, application performance acceleration, and cloud security services. Akamai's edge network processes massive volumes of web traffic, making it a high-visibility target for distributed denial-of-service attacks while simultaneously positioning the company to detect and mitigate those threats across its customer base. The platform runs workloads closer to users, reducing latency for digital experiences while providing distributed infrastructure for threat detection and response. Akamai's cybersecurity services protect applications and infrastructure against evolving threats, with particular focus on DDoS protection - a domain where the company's visibility into global internet traffic patterns provides operational advantages. The threat model spans volumetric attacks, application-layer exploits, and infrastructure-targeted campaigns. Led by CEO Dr. Tom Leighton and headquartered in the United States, Akamai serves enterprises globally across industries requiring high-performance content delivery, robust security postures, and protection for customer-facing digital properties.

Milestone Technologies, Inc.

Milestone Technologies is a global IT services and digital solutions provider founded in 1997 and headquartered in Silicon Valley. The company evolved from a small team of engineers into an enterprise partner serving hundreds of leading corporations across payments, hi-tech, media and entertainment, and healthtech sectors. As a trusted Microsoft Solution Partner with specialized expertise in Azure and digital innovation, Milestone delivers end-to-end managed services, cloud transformation, data and AI solutions, and digital workplace enablement designed to help enterprises scale technology infrastructure securely and efficiently. The company's technical practice areas span managed services, cloud and infrastructure engineering, platform engineering, application development, and AI and automation. Milestone's cloud transformation services focus on modernizing and migrating enterprise systems to cloud environments, with particular depth in Azure deployments. The platform engineering and infrastructure teams build and maintain operational platforms that support enterprise-scale operations, while the AI and automation practice develops solutions to drive measurable business outcomes through data-driven capabilities. Milestone positions its value proposition around combining technical excellence with strategic business insight, transforming enterprise technology challenges into opportunities for digital transformation. The company's approach emphasizes secure, efficient scaling of technology infrastructure - a positioning that reflects both its engineering roots and its work across regulated industries like payments and healthtech where security and compliance are critical business requirements. Under CEO Sameer Kishore's leadership, Milestone continues to expand its global footprint while maintaining its Silicon Valley technical heritage.
